interface ErrorConstructor { /** * Indicates whether the argument provided is a built-in Error instance or not. */ isError(error: unknown): error is Error; } interface RegExpConstructor { /** * Escapes any RegExp syntax characters in the input string, returning a * new string that can be safely interpolated into a RegExp as a literal * string to match. * @example * ```ts * const regExp = new RegExp(RegExp.escape("foo.bar")); * regExp.test("foo.bar"); // true * regExp.test("foo!bar"); // false * ``` */ escape(string: string): string; }
